Home Shopify customer loyalty

Detailed Guide for An Effective Customer Loyalty Program in 2023

by OneCommerce
Loyalty program

As we all know, customer loyalty is a great way to increase revenue and keep customers coming back. In fact, 84% of consumers say they’re more likely to stick with a brand that offers a loyalty program. And up to 66% of consumers admit the ability to earn rewards actually changes their shopping behavior.

Acquiring new customers can be a costly investment for brands, which is why many companies focus on loyalty and rewards programs for their repeat customers instead. Even though customer loyalty programs can be effective, they’re not new by any means. That’s why some retailers are looking to break the mold and find innovative new ways to build rewards programs that will truly inspire customer loyalty.

To solve this problem, we will discuss what a customer loyalty program is, how a business can benefit from it, and how it can work for a business. Most importantly, this blog will cover some ways to build an effective customer loyalty program to keep customers loyal to your business.

Let’s get started!

What is a customer loyalty program?

A loyalty program is a system designed to encourage customers to continue doing business with a company. 

Those programs can be sponsored by retailers, businesses, or even individuals. 

66% of loyalty program members spend more money to maximize points earnings Bond Brand Loyalty

As we all know, incentivizing customers with points is an effective way to get them to spend more on brands.  And with a loyalty program, customers earn these points for every purchase they make, which customers can redeem for discounts, coupons, freebies, free shipping, or other rewards. The more points a customer accumulates, the greater the rewards they can earn. 

With a loyalty program, customers can earn points for every purchase they make

With a loyalty program, customers can earn points for every purchase they make

So if you’re looking for a way to show your appreciation to your customers, a loyalty program can be a perfect solution to keep customers coming back. Moreover, it can be used to increase brand awareness and customer loyalty.

Benefits of customer loyalty programs 

Loyalty programs have proven to be one of the most effective ways for retaining customers by rewarding them. Therefore, it comes as no surprise that such programs offer tons of benefits for businesses and consumers alike.

customer loyalty

Customer loyalty programs can be an excellent way for businesses to show appreciation for their customers

1. For businesses

Loyalty programs can help increase customer retention and boost sales. Not to mention, you can also gain deeper and more valuable insights into your customer’s shopping behaviors. 

To be particular, a loyalty program provides additional data points based on what types of products are often purchased together and whether specific incentives are more effective than others. This data can be used to improve your business products and services

This eventually helps improve both your customer experience and your conversions as well.

2. For customers

Loyalty programs can provide customers with savings on purchases, rewards for spending, and early access to exclusive products, deals, and offers. Moreover, customer loyalty programs can be an essential part of a business’s marketing strategy and can be tailored to fit the company’s specific needs. 

For example, a business might offer a loyalty program that gives customers a discount on their next purchase if they spend a certain amount of money in a given period of time. 

Or, a business might offer a loyalty program that gives customers points for every purchase they make, which can be redeemed for rewards such as discounts, free items, or exclusive access to sales and events.

Overall, loyalty programs can also be an excellent way for businesses to show appreciation for their customers. By offering benefits and rewards, companies can let their customers know they value their patronage. This can help create a strong sense of customer loyalty which can, in turn, lead to repeat purchasing and positive word-of-mouth marketing.

The customer loyalty program can lead to repeat purchasing and positive word-of-mouth marketing

The customer loyalty program can lead to repeat purchasing and positive word-of-mouth marketing

Now that you have acknowledged what a customer loyalty program can bring to your business, it’s time you start working on it. Still, you will need to find an app to create loyalty programs that suits your needs and budget. 

Best Shopify loyalty app to implement your campaign

Before discussing the app options, there are 9 key features that the best Shopify loyalty program apps should have. Let’s review them quickly, so you will know what to look for when choosing a customer-loyal app for your store.

  1. Easy setup with no coding required
  2. A user-friendly interface
  3. Deliver personalized offers
  4. Automated loyalty program management
  5. The ability to handle customer data securely and efficiently
  6. Support multi-lingual 
  7. Reasonable price
  8. Integration with other Shopify apps
  9. Timely customer support

So now, are you thinking of going to the Shopify app store and browsing for loyalty apps that meet the 9 criteria above? 

No, you don’t have to do that. Cause we’ve done the hard work for you and compiled a list of the top 3 customer loyalty apps for the job without breaking the bank. So, be sure to check out our top picks!

1. OneLoyalty ‑ Loyalty & Rewards by Onecommerce

Rating: 4.0/5

Pricing: Free 

If you’ve been running a store on Shopify for a while now, you might have noticed that it’s getting harder to attach your customers to an old, less exciting loyalty program. And you know your loyalty program will only be successful if you make it attractive and valuable to customers. 

Luckily, OneLoyalty has the tools you need to make your campaigns more engaging, and it‘s completely FREE!

customer loyalty

Highlight Features

  • A rich template library that includes widgets, email templates, and more to get you started quickly and easily. 
  • Multi-lingual loyalty widget: the app helps auto-translate your loyalty widget into any language that’s in your Shopify Market settings
  • Exciting point-earning missions: motivate customers to complete fun-filled missions to earn points: Joining your loyalty program, Placing an order, Engaging on social media, Celebrating birthdays, etc.
  • Diverse redemption options: customers can earn redeemed points for various rewards, like discounts, free shipping, or products
  • VIP tiered programs: pamper your most loyal customers with VIP treatments. Give them VIP status and better accessibility to more exclusive deals and discounts!
  • Automatic email: keep your customers in the loop with their points, VIP status, and birthday presents using our fully-customizable email templates

2. Loyalty, rewards & referrals by LoyaltyLion

Rating: 4.4/5

Pricing: From $159/month. Free plan available.

customer loyalty

LoyaltyLion is another eCommerce business tool that helps retain customers by adding a loyalty and rewards program. You can add it to your store in minutes without any technical expertise required. By encouraging customers to redeem points for rewards at your store, you increase the chances of them staying loyal to you and increase your store’s revenue. With a free plan available, you can enjoy your own unique loyalty program that reflects your brand identity. However, this app offers limited features. If you want to add advanced features, you will be charged (from) $5/month. 

Highlight Features

  • A loyalty program as unique as your brand: bring your brand to life and create emotional connections through your loyal program
  • More significant gains in customer lifetime value: Increase engagement, repeat purchase rates, and average order values with points awarded for non-transaction activity.
  • Personalize experience wherever your customers are: Turn your existing shoppers into advocates and a cost-effective acquisition channel.

3. Gift Cards & Loyalty Program by Rise.ai

Rating: 4.8/5

Pricing: From $19.99/month. 7-day free trial. Additional charges may apply.

customer loyalty

The Rise app is a fantastic tool for small businesses that want to establish a customer loyalty program. By using automated store credit rewards, companies can attract a loyal customer base that will act as brand ambassadors and help spread word of mouth. 

Plus, customers can send branded Gift Cards directly to recipients using the Gift Card gallery & customization options. However, the monthly pricing may be too high for new merchants: the starter plan 19.99$/month, and for small businesses 59.99$/month.

Highlight Features

  • Build your gift card program: flexibly build an enhanced Gift Card and Store Credit program on every Shopify plan.
  • Automatic Rules and Custom recommendations for sending Store Credit: create as many rules as you want to boost member loyalty, satisfaction, and retention.
  • Increase marketing capabilities by using bulk gift cards: send a bulk gift card and bulk discount campaigns.
  • One-click checkout: quickly apply and easy to custom – all vitals included.

How to create a customer loyalty program on Shopify

With a customer loyalty program, you can offer incentives like discounts, coupons, and exclusive deals to keep your customers coming back. Therefore, it’s time for you to learn how to create one and reward your best customers for winning their loyalty.

One of the simpliest and best ways to decide which loyalty app to use is to to take a look on the shopify stores who are doing best. Koala Inspector provides you with all the secrets behind every Shopify store, including your competitors and therefore implement them in your shop.

Additionally, there are a couple of really good options for you to consider, such as Oneloyalty (completely FREE) or LoyaltyLion( with a free plan included or a starter plan from $159 per month). No matter what app you choose, remember that your choice should come down to your specific needs, budget and preferences.

Once you’ve decided on the app you want, it’s time to choose the type of loyalty program you want. The 2 most common types are:

  • Points Programs: Customers can earn points through purchases and actions at your Shopify store, which they can later redeem for free products, free shipping, cash back, discounts, or coupons.
  • Tiered Loyalty Programs: Loyalty programs with multiple tiers are designed to offer increasingly valuable rewards to members as they reach certain milestones. These milestones are often measured in money spent, so the more members spend, the more they progress through the tiers.
Customers can earn points through purchases and actions at your Shopify store

Customers can earn points through purchases and actions at your Shopify store

So, have you decided on the loyalty program you want to set up for your business yet? If so, great! As you get started, here are six things to keep in mind.

1. Keep everything simple and concise

It’s essential to keep your loyalty and rewards program simple and concise so that your customers don’t get overwhelmed and give up on using it. You can use a digital customer experience platform to improve customer service and explain things in a way that is easy for them to understand. This will help keep them engaged with your program so that they continue using it.

2. Research what motivates your customers

Before offering customers any type of loyalty or rewards program, it is crucial to do your research and first understand what your target audience is and what motivates them. Then, what are they looking for in such a deal? What would they find valuable? 

With this crucial information, it’ll be easier to create a successful program that meets the needs and wants of your customers.

One of the best ways to know what will work best for your customers is to simply ask them for their feedback! You can get their input through post-purchase surveys, social media polls, or email campaigns. This way, you can remove any guesswork and tailor your approach to what your customers want. 

3. Don’t set too difficult or time-consuming goals 

If your rewards program is too difficult to complete or customers have to invest a lot of time to get a reward, they’ll likely give up on it altogether. As a result, this will leave you feeling frustrated and like you’ve wasted your time and energy. 

Instead, you should focus on setting attainable goals that will provide a sense of accomplishment for your customers.

4. Introduce personalization

Something as small as sending out birthday cards or greeting your customers by name can significantly impact your relationship with them. By going the extra mile to show your best customers that you appreciate their business, you’ll inspire them to continue shopping with you in the future.

5. Keep your loyalty program engaging and exciting

It’s important to keep your loyalty program engaging and exciting to stand out from the rest. With so many different programs available, most customers already participate in several others. So, if your want to keep them interested in yours, you need to make sure it has plenty of perks and benefits that they’ll appreciate.

6. Be prepared to adjust your plans

As your business grows with time, your customer loyalty program should grow along with it. Therefore, be prepared to change and update your loyalty program as needed to ensure that it is still relevant and provides value to your customers.


A customer loyalty program is an excellent way to encourage repeat customers and increase brand value. Besides, loyalty programs can incentivize repeat purchases, drive customer engagement, or retain customers. Therefore, it is essential to consider how involved you want your program to be and what your end goal is in establishing it. 

We hope you enjoyed OneCommerce‘s article about customer loyalty programs. With this helpful knowledge, you can build your own loyalty program and improve your campaign. So, if you haven’t created a loyalty program for your Shopify store yet, it is the perfect time to get started!

Related Posts